Output 3db27649027a48857aabf69f2f8477fc6de1d8ef1ce89c0319d9e2d87fc1b978:0

value
14687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8545f805009da3ae35142d59ec784c00b5d56995 OP_EQUAL
address
3DqhcaPY4ez52RSUe1ortu9ytjnXi8Z59z
transaction
3db27649027a48857aabf69f2f8477fc6de1d8ef1ce89c0319d9e2d87fc1b978
confirmations
107686
spent
true